The Challenge
Most current AI chat products are designed around isolated chat experiences. Users can interact with AI models, but they have limited control over personality, long-term memory, worldbuilding, or content ownership. Creators also lack dedicated tools to publish, monetize, and manage AI-powered experiences within a single ecosystem, and many AI chatbot products still stop short of giving creators that full stack. Competitive expectations for an AI app also include core features like customization, memory, moderation, and cross-platform access.
The objective was to build a comprehensive AI platform capable of supporting, while addressing crucial factors such as scalability, safety, and personalization:

In budget terms, a basic AI chat MVP often starts around $40,000 and takes 3 to 4 months, while more capable versions can run $160,000 to $400,000 or more and take 5 to 7 months, with ongoing AI costs ranging from $3,000 to $150,000 per month.

Intelligent Conversational AI Companions
Users can interact with highly personalized AI companions that use natural language processing and machine learning to maintain context, adapt to individual preferences, and deliver contextually appropriate responses across multiple interaction styles. Dialogue management tracks conversation history for longer-term interaction and helps the system generate contextually relevant replies. Sentiment analysis and emotion recognition also improve empathy and realism in conversation, making interactions feel closer to real life.
Custom Character Creation
A comprehensive creation workflow allows users to build original AI characters. The process of character development (character development includes conceptualization, configuration, training, and management) typically involves:
-
Conceptualization: Defining the character’s purpose, personality, and role.
-
Configuration: Setting up persona customization (persona customization includes defining character name, description, backstory, and greeting).
-
Training: Using example dialogues and feedback for behavior tuning (behavior tuning involves shaping conversational consistency through example dialogues and feedback).
-
Management: Ongoing updates and refinement of the character’s attributes and behaviors.

Privacy-First Local AI and Data Security
Unlike cloud-only AI services, the platform supports local model execution, giving users complete ownership of conversations and greater control over sensitive data while reducing reliance on external infrastructure. The table below compares cloud-only and local AI approaches:
| Feature | Cloud-Only AI | Local AI Execution |
|---|---|---|
| Data Ownership | Limited | Complete |
| Privacy | Dependent on provider | User-controlled |
| Performance | Network-dependent | Device-dependent |
| Compliance | Varies | Easier to manage |

The conversational AI market reached $5.4 billion in 2024 and is projected to hit $15.5 billion by 2030, which reinforces the need to plan for a growing user base from the start.
Consumer-facing AI apps are expected to grow from $1.8 billion to $6.2 billion by 2030, and category leaders already handle hundreds of millions of messages monthly—Character AI alone processed 500 million messages in 2023—so platforms built for millions of interactions need infrastructure that can scale efficiently.
